Basin Head Provincial Beach is more than just a stretch of sand; it's a natural concert hall. As you shuffle your feet across the fine, silica-rich grains, a distinct, high-pitched squeak—the famous 'singing sands'—emanates from beneath. This rare phenomenon, found in only a few places worldwide, transforms a simple walk into an interactive auditory experience, captivating visitors from their very first step.

Beyond its sonic allure, Basin Head boasts a breathtaking landscape. The beach is flanked by a natural run, a narrow channel that connects the ocean to a warm, shallow basin, perfect for families with young children. The water here is often significantly warmer than the open ocean, creating an ideal environment for splashing and play. The vibrant blue of the water contrasts beautifully with the pale, singing sand and the verdant dunes.
Adding to its charm, a wooden bridge spans the run, offering a popular spot for thrill-seekers to jump into the refreshing waters below. Lifeguards are on duty during peak season, ensuring a safe and enjoyable experience for everyone.
